Why Do Dogs Eat Womens Pants?

If you have a dog, you may have noticed that he or she chews on underwear. This behavior can be quite surprising. However, there are a few reasons why dogs like to eat underwear. By understanding the cause of these habits, you can prevent embarrassment for yourself and your pet.

First, dogs have a very strong sense of smell. Their noses are up to ten times more sensitive than those of humans. They can detect human scents and the pheromones that come with them. Underwear carries these pheromones, which makes it appealing to dogs.

Another reason why dogs like to eat underwear is that they like the taste. Some dogs prefer female underwear and others like to lick the crotch area of men’s underwear.

If your dog is eating underwear, it is best to check with a veterinarian to get a diagnosis. The fabric that is ingested may cause intestinal blockages. In addition, ingested material can cause weight loss and fever. Dogs can also experience nervous issues as a result of this eating behavior.

Dogs love to chew, and it is a natural part of their growth. Many dogs lick fabrics and chew objects that have no nutritional value. These behaviors are called pica. Pica can affect both animals and humans.

Why is My Dog Obsessed with My Clothes?

If you’re a dog owner, you’re probably already aware that your dog has a taste for your clothes. While many dogs will sleep on your clothing, others will snatch, chew, and even tear it to shreds. However, if you’re concerned about your dog’s thievery, there are some steps you can take to stop it.

For starters, make sure you have a good quality bed for your pooch. It’s also a good idea to encourage him to get off the clothes by offering him a treat for dropping them.

Another tip is to keep your closet doors closed and any tempting objects out of his reach. You may also want to invest in some novelty toys that will keep your pooch entertained for hours.

Finally, consider your dog’s age. Small dogs and puppies may be a little more apt to snatch at your clothes than older dogs or pups. In addition, they might be teething. So you might want to consider a few teething toys to help discourage your puppy from carrying your clothes.
